The Round House - Panoramic views of Ilfracombe
A truly unique holiday home surrounded by beautifully landscaped gardens.
True to its name, The Round House is a unique and grand holiday home offering distinctive features, beautiful furnishings, and wonderful views over the town and out towards the Bristol Channel. Ideal for an enjoyable break with family or friends.

The unique building is an 'Italianate' style circular property that also comes with a separate, detached quirky cottage. Located right next to the Cairn Nature Reserve - a historic woodland area - there are dozens of walking trails on the doorstep - if you can drag yourself away, that is. It's also within a healthy walking distance of the beach, The South West Coast Path and Ilfracombe town centre.
Constructed from stone and Marland brick, the five-bedroom property is approached by a sweeping drive, surrounded by colourful, landscaped gardens, which have been a frequent winner of ‘Ilfracombe in Bloom’.
Inside, the house is dripping with architectural features, including twin turrets which flank the main entrance, ornate plaster ceilings, original Arts and Crafts fireplaces and gothic-style arched doors and wood-panelled walls.
The front door opens into a turreted entrance with an ornate gilded patterned plastered ceiling and herringbone parquet flooring leading towards the drawing room. This features a bowed picture window with a window seat below, so you can gaze out at the hypnotic sea views.
The dining room, too, boasts a large bow window along with an open fireplace and enough marble to rival the Vatican. The ground floor also contains a breakfast room, kitchen, laundry room, and cloakroom.
Upstairs, the five bedrooms command enviable views. However, the real jewel in the crown is the spectacular rotunda room, featuring a circular wall of double-glazed windows, four painted wooden pillar supports and a door opening onto a roof terrace and sun deck. Perfect for admiring the panoramic views across the Bristol Channel and out towards Wales in the distance.

North Devon is probably best known for its award-winning coastline, much of which is a designated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. The golden sandy beaches are perfect for rock-pooling, swimming, and surfing, in fact, much of the coast is the UK’s top surfing spot. Combine this with dramatic coastlines, rugged moors, and verdant valleys that all demand to be explored, and you’ll never be short of things to do.

There’s a diverse range of attractions. If you love being outdoors, this is the perfect part of the country to visit. Take part in a whole host of thrill-seeking activities from surfing, kayaking, paddleboarding and more in the coastal areas or get on your bike or pull on your hiking boots and explore the scenery.
Exmoor is full of beautiful walking trails and wildlife, including the renowned Exmoor ponies, which wander wild around the moor – there is something very special about settling down for a picnic following a bracing walk and watching the ponies against the backdrop of the moor.
Plus, there is the famous Tarka Trail, named after Henry Williamson’s delightful novel, ‘Tarka the Otter’. North Devon and Exmoor aren’t just for the outdoorsy types. There’s a whole host of amazing attractions, great local food and drink. Ilfracombe, in particular, is gaining a reputation as a foodie hotspot with plenty for couples, families, and friends to enjoy a broad range of cuisine.
You can also discover charming market towns and quaint villages that attract visitors in their thousands. Take a trip to Clovelly and see the cobbled streets and traditional cottages, or head to Barnstaple, the oldest and largest town in the area. For seaside resorts, take a look at the towns of Woolacombe, Westward Ho!, Bideford and Ilfracombe, or for the ultimate surfer’s paradise, Croyde and Saunton are the places to be!
